As I said, the development list was private for most of the 90s, there is
no publicly available record. Membership in the development list was by
invitation only, the location of the gcc snapshots was secret (with nasty
messages threatening to ban any developer who revealed the location to the
public). This was one of the issues in the egcs/gcc split.
